MEATBALLS: THE SPUNTINO WAY
Provided by Frank Falcinelli
Categories Beef Bake Dinner Meat Ground Beef Peanut Free Soy Free
Yield Makes 6 servings; 18 to 20 meatballs
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- 1. Heat the oven to 325°F. Put the fresh bread in a bowl, cover it with water, and let it soak for a minute or so. Pour off the water and wring out the bread, then crumble and tear it into tiny pieces.
- 2. Combine the bread with all the remaining ingredients except the tomato sauce in a medium mixing bowl, adding them in the order they are listed. Add the dried bread crumbs last to adjust for wetness: the mixture should be moist wet, not sloppy wet.
- 3. Shape the meat mixture into handball-sized meatballs and space them evenly on a baking sheet.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es. The meatballs will be firm but still juicy and gently yielding when they're cooked through. (At this point, you can cool the meatballs and hold them in the refrigerator for as long as a couple of days or freeze them for the future.)
- 4. Meanwhile, heat the tomato sauce in a sauté pan large enough to accommodate the meatballs comfortably.
- 5. Dump the meatballs into the pan of sauce and nudge the heat up ever so slightly. Simmer the meatballs for half an hour or so (this isn't one of those cases where longer is better) so they can soak up some sauce. Keep them there until it's time to eat.
- 6. Serve the meatballs 3 to a person in a healthy helping of the red sauce, and hit everybody's portion-never the pan-with a fluffy mountain of grated cheese. Reserve the leftover tomato sauce (it will be super-extra-delicious) and use it anywhere tomato sauce is called for in this book.

SWEDISH MEATBALLS - MY WAY
Want to get the nutritional information. Originally from Alton Brown, but modified for my preferences.
Provided by coffee31807
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 55m
Yield 4 , 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
- Tear the bread into pieces and place in a small mixing bowl along with the milk. Set aside.
- In a 12-inch saute pan over medium heat, melt 1 tbls of butter. Add the onion and a pinch of salt and sweat until the onions are soft. Remove from the heat and set aside.
- In a bowl, combine the bread and milk mixture, ground beef, eggbeaters, 1 tsp Kosher salt, black pepper, allspice, parsley, numeg, and onions. Mix by hand until well combined.
- Using your hands, roll mixture into meatballs.
- Bake at 350 degrees F. in ungreased shallow baking pan for 15 - 20 minutes. Remove with a slotted spoon and drain well.
- Use some of the meatball juices in the saute pan, over low heat, add flour to the pan and whisk until lightly browned, approximately 1 - 2 minutes. Gradually add teh beef stock and mushrooms and whisk until the sauce thickens. Add the milk and continue to cook until the gravey reaches the desired consistency.
- Serve meatballs and gravy over noodles of choice.
